Teradyne Completes Acquisition of AutoGuide Mobile Robots

Teradyne, Inc. has announced that it has completed the acquisition of AutoGuide Mobile Robots, a leading supplier of high payload autonomous mobile robots (AMRs). AutoGuide’s advanced products deliver easy deployment, improved safety, reduced costs and increased efficiency of industrial and warehouse material-handling operations.
